<p>Healthcare systems face increasing demands and cost pressures, driving a focus on efficiency improvements, particularly in hospitals. This study examines the efficiency of 35 urology departments in Austrian publicly funded hospitals (including public and private non-profit) using slack-based Data Envelopment Analysis (DEA) on 2017–2019 data. We analyse efficiency drivers via second-stage regression, focusing on processes, structures, and the external environment, to understand performance differences by ownership. Initial DEA results suggest higher efficiency in private non-profit hospitals. However, second-stage regression reveals that these seemingly more efficient private units benefit from a more advantageous external environment, characterized by fewer unplanned, night-time or weekend admissions. Crucially, when controlling for these environmental factors, the efficiency advantage of private hospitals diminishes or even reverses. To rigorously assess the impact of methodological choices, specifically the inclusion of environmental controls that capture differences in service provision roles, we conduct a meta-regression across 768 model specifications. This result demonstrates the significant influence of accounting for these contextual factors on the relative efficiency assessment of public versus private non-profit units, potentially explaining mixed results in prior literature. The findings are in line with both theoretical and empirical work regarding the shortcomings and potential unintended consequences of financial incentives in hospital financing. They underscore the critical need for hospital efficiency evaluations and funding models to account for the heterogeneous service provision roles and patient populations served by different hospital types. Failing to control for environmental factors can lead to biased conclusions favouring hospitals operating in less challenging contexts. The detailed department-level analysis and the robust methodological framework, highlighting the sensitivity to modelling choices, offer valuable insights for health policy aimed at equitable resource allocation and targeted efficiency improvements across the diverse landscape of publicly funded hospitals.</p>
